ftDuino/Einrichten

Aus ZUM-Unterrichten

Dies ist eine kürzere Version des ftDuino -Manuals, das Du auf harbaum.github.io findest.

Computer vorbereiten

Prinzipiell kann der ftDuino mit fast jedem Rechner verbunden werden.

Installation des IoServer-Sketches auf dem ftDuino.

  1. Installieren der Arduino IDE
    1. In Datei ► Einstellungen unter "zusätzliche Boardverwalter -URLs https://harbaum.github.io/ftduino/package_ftduino_index.json
      eingeben
    2. Danach ist der ftDuino im Boardverwalter auswählbar. Durch ein Klick auf "Installieren" wird die ftDuino-Unterstützung in die Arduino-IDE eingebunden.
    3. Um den IoServer-Sketch zu laden, müssen Sie in der Arduino IDE auf
      Datei ► Beispiele ► WebUSB ► IoServer
      gehen und den Sketch mit Klick auf 🢂 kompilieren und laden
      (Wenn das nicht klappt, weil eine Adafruit-GFX-Bibliothek geladen werden muss, in
      Sketch ► Bibliothek einbinden ► Bibliothek verwalten
      gehen, dort den Namen eingeben und installieren
  2. Öffnen Sie Ihren Chrome oder Edge-Browser
    1. Geben Sie manuell: https://harbaum.github.io/ftduino/webusb/console/ ein.
    2. Klicken Sie auf ftDuino und "verbinden"
    3. Falls dies nicht funktioniert, zuerst noch manuell WinUSB-Treiber über Zadig - https://zadig.akeo.ie/ laden

Siehe:

Anschluss

  1. Anschluss des ftDuino per USB an den PC
  2. Öffnen der Scratch-Webseite Scratch 3 GUI in Chrome oder Edge.
    Dies ist nicht die eigentliche scratch.mit.edu-Seite - sie enthält die passende ftDuino -Extension:
    1. Links unten findest du folgenden Button:
      Scratch3 extsel.png




      Klick ihn an!
    2. Wähle die Extension aus.
    3. Nun sollte neben der grünen Flagge oben ein grüner Stecker sein:
      FtDuino-Extension.jpg

      Falls Du zum erstem Mal auf den ftDuino zugreifst (oranger Stecker), musst du ihn erst aktivieren.



Aktivierung

  1. Öffnen Sie Ihren Chrome oder Edge-Browser
    1. Geben Sie manuell: https://harbaum.github.io/ftduino/webusb/console/ ein.
    2. Klicken Sie auf ftDuino und "verbinden"